All rectangles are parallelorams.Are all parallelograms rectangles? Explain​

Definitions of parallelogram and rectangle:

A parallelogram is a quadrilateral in which both pairs of opposite sides are parallel.

A rectangle is a parallelogram with four right angles.

This gives us that each rectangle is a parallelogram.

But an arbitrary parallelogram can have angles that are not necessarily right (for example, 60°, 120°, 60°, 120°). Thus, there are a lot of parallelograms that are not rectangles.
